1. Toshiba Gigabeat S Series

The one gadget that grabbed everyone at Engadget's attention right at the beginning of the show was Toshiba's new Gigabeat S Series Portable Media Center. Portable video players are a dime-a-dozen these days, but the new Gigabeat looks like it'll have the skills to take on the iPod: a sleek, thin, light brushed aluminum casing, a crisp, bright QVGA display, and -- and here's the really important part -- it offers full integration with Vongo, that new online video download subscription service from Starz that'll let you download as many movies as you want from their catalog and watch them on your portable device.

QUOTE( microsoft spec site thing)
Just announced! The Toshiba Gigabeat S Series Portable Media Center offers a vivid 2.4" color display and an extended storage capacity, so you can take your favorite digital media with you. Download recorded TV shows from TiVo Series2 or feature-length movies from movie studio Web sites, and then watch them on your Portable Media Center or a TV. Listen to music and download album art from online music providers. Tune into your favorite FM radio station with the unique FM tuner feature. Create impressive photo shows set to music, or enjoy interactive gaming with integrated audio for Microsoft Xbox 360™. Available Spring 2006.
Features

    *
      Compact dimensions with up to 60 gigabytes (GB) of storage space
    *
      FM radio tuner
    *
      Extended battery life (20 hours of audio and up to 5 hours of video)
    *
      Familiar Windows Mobile software navigation
    *
      Compatible with popular media file formats, including .wmv, .wav, JPEG, and MP3
    *
      Media download from Media Center PCs
    *
      Recorded TV download from TiVo Series2
    *
      Audio integration with Xbox 360
    *
      Available in Metallic Blue, Piano Black, and Piano White
